If you’re in your teenage or twenties, chances are your face isn’t completely free from acne. Due to significant hormonal changes during this stage, the androgen hormones stimulate acne production in your skin. A sedentary lifestyle, consuming junk, and using products that intensify the oily and greasy proportion of your skin can create an imbalance of the oil quotient, leading to proliferating acne on your skin, causing a nightmare.

Precautionary Follow-up
Acne-prone sensitive skin could be a burden to deal with. However, some precautions might lighten up this burden of yours.
- When using face washes for acne-prone skin, take precautions for optimal results. Go through the step of patch testing with new products, introduce them gradually and avoid harsh scrubbing.
- Don’t overwash, follow instructions, and use a non-comedogenic moisturiser. Apply SPF, as acne treatments can increase sun sensitivity.
- Refrain from touching your face, limit multiple products, and watch for irritation.
- Cleanse after sweating, and regularly clean makeup tools.
